摘要: Detours 代码仓库: https://github.com/microsoft/Detours x64写一个任意地址hook要比x86麻烦的多,所以这里直接封装框架来用于x64的hook。 Detours是微软发布的一个API hook框架,同时支持x86和x64,看文档说也支持ARM和ARM 阅读全文
posted @ 2023-12-22 17:51 Python成长路 阅读(464) 评论(0) 推荐(0)
摘要: 最简单的Hook 刚开始学的时候,用的hook都是最基础的5字节hook,也不会使用hook框架,hook流程如下: 构建一个jmp指令跳转到你的函数(函数需定义为裸函数) 保存被hook地址的至少5字节机器码,然后写入构建的jmp指令 接着在你的代码里做你想要的操作 以内联汇编的形式执行被hook 阅读全文
posted @ 2023-12-21 09:42 Python成长路 阅读(579) 评论(0) 推荐(3)
摘要: 优化内容 这篇不聊技术点,说一下优化后的Python机器人代码怎么使用,优化内容如下: 将hook库独立成一个库,发布到pypi,可使用pip安装 将微信相关的代码发布成另一个库,也可以pip安装 git仓库统一,以后都在这个仓库更新,不再一篇文章一个仓库 开始建群,根据群里反馈增加功能和修复bug 阅读全文
posted @ 2023-12-20 09:36 Python成长路 阅读(419) 评论(0) 推荐(1)
摘要: 需求 有些应用每次启动都需要用管理员权限运行,比如Python注入dll时,编辑器或cmd就需要以管理员权限运行,不然注入就会失败。 这篇文章用编程怎么修改配置实现打开某个软件都是使用管理员运行,就不用每次都右键点击以管理员身份运行此程序。主要是给小白配置,防止他忘了以管理员权限运行,又跑过来问我为 阅读全文
posted @ 2023-12-19 09:26 Python成长路 阅读(596) 评论(0) 推荐(1)
摘要: 为什么需要热加载 在某些情况,你可能不希望关闭Python进程并重新打开,或者你无法重新启动Python,这时候就需要实现实时修改代码实时生效,而不用重新启动Python 在我的需求下,这个功能非常重要,我将Python注入到了其他进程,并作为一个线程运行。如果我想关闭Python,要么杀死Pyth 阅读全文
posted @ 2023-12-18 19:15 Python成长路 阅读(538) 评论(1) 推荐(2)
摘要: 前言 在之前的一篇文章( 远程连接被爆破的最佳解决办法)中,提到如何避免远程桌面被爆破。有人私信说步骤太复杂,也发了他们在用的一些方案: 通过安全狗来设置主机名作为白名单条件 softether组件局域网(和zerotier类似) 通过RouterOS设置某些情况下的请求将ip加入到白名单,比如弄个 阅读全文
posted @ 2023-12-06 13:59 Python成长路 阅读(310) 评论(0) 推荐(0)
摘要: 前言 之前写了一篇文章为一加七Pro(LineageOs17.1 4.14内核版本)编译KernelSu,最近想换个系统玩玩,因为我发现我自己编译的系统总是被某些APP风控了,比如淘宝有些活动就参与不了。 正好可以试试PixelExperience,顺便为PixelExperience编译一个配套的 阅读全文
posted @ 2023-11-24 15:27 Python成长路 阅读(427) 评论(0) 推荐(0)
摘要: 目录修整 目前的系列目录(后面会根据实际情况变动): 在windows11上编译python 将python注入到其他进程并运行 注入Python并使用ctypes主动调用进程内的函数和读取内存结构体 使用汇编引擎调用进程内的任意函数 利用beaengine反汇编引擎的c接口写一个pyd库,用于实现 阅读全文
posted @ 2023-10-31 14:40 Python成长路 阅读(204) 评论(0) 推荐(0)
摘要: 这是做什么用的 框架用途 在采集大量新闻网站时,不可避免的遇到动态加载的网站,这给配模版的人增加了很大难度。本来配静态网站只需要两个技能点:xpath和正则,如果是动态网站的还得抓包,遇到加密的还得js逆向。 所以就需要用浏览器渲染这些动态网站,来减少了配模板的工作难度和技能要求。动态加载的网站在新 阅读全文
posted @ 2023-10-27 13:57 Python成长路 阅读(546) 评论(0) 推荐(0)
摘要: 目录修整 目前的系列目录(后面会根据实际情况变动): 在windows11上编译python 将python注入到其他进程并运行 使用C++写一个python的pyd库,用于实现inline hook Python ctypes库的使用 使用ctypes主动调用进程内的任意函数 使用汇编引擎调用进程 阅读全文
posted @ 2023-10-23 17:11 Python成长路 阅读(300) 评论(0) 推荐(0)